Canalejas Center Madrid, Winner of LIT Design Awards in Exterior Architectural Illumination

The seven buildings that form Canalejas Center are framed by ten façades, built at different times from 1882 to 1974 with different styles and unique elements.

The intention was to establish a unifying criterion without losing the unique characteristics of each façade. Therefore, an integrated lighting scheme was designed to cover all 10 façades and to create an overall recognizable identity: It illuminates the main axes and all the architectural elements that distinguish each façade, thus creating an overall harmonic composition. A deliberate result was achieved by selecting small luminaires and tailor-made shielded fixtures. Fine-tuned light levels, to reduce energy consumption and light pollution, was a vital requirement in this project.
